Output 7975290c90bac4d5b1568a78d1f52a5cf269e0a635449a1efbdd34c6c67a14da:17

value
707268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e68f56fc993a27aec412f2a3deee39b825788d OP_EQUAL
address
3EuBRkYGiyH7dTBnPvCbbFx5Cb5cV58vRW
transaction
7975290c90bac4d5b1568a78d1f52a5cf269e0a635449a1efbdd34c6c67a14da
spent
true